// Wrapper type for a node's data layout.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// There are 3 32-bit unsigned integers that act as a header. These
|
||||
// integers represent the following values in this order:
|
||||
//
|
||||
// (1) The reference count of the key held by the node. This is 0 if
|
||||
// the node doesn't hold a key.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// (2) The number of characters in the node's prefix. The prefix is a
|
||||
// part of one or more keys in the tree, e.g. the prefix of each node
|
||||
// in a trie consists of a single character.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// (3) The number of outgoing edges from this node.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// The rest of the layout consists of 3 chunks in this order:
|
||||
//
|
||||
// (1) The node's prefix as a sequence of one or more bytes. The root
|
||||
// node always has an empty prefix, unlike other nodes in the tree.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// (2) The first byte of the prefix of each of this node's children.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// (3) The pointer to each child node.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// The link to each child is looked up using its index, e.g. the child
|
||||
// with index 0 will have its first byte and node pointer at the start
|
||||
// of the chunk of first bytes and node pointers respectively.
